Meaning and Origin

Philomena, of Greek origin, means "lover of strength". It's a powerful name that evokes a sense of enduring love and courage. This ancient name has roots in Greek mythology and its connection to the early saint and martyr of Rome, Filumena, adds to its mystique. While the exact origin of the name is debated, its association with the Greek word "phileo," meaning "to love", makes it a name brimming with warmth and strength.

Religion and Cultural Associations

Philomena has strong ties to Christianity. Saint Philomena is a revered figure in the Catholic Church, and the name is often associated with her story of faith and perseverance. This religious significance might be particularly appealing to families with strong religious ties.

Nickname Choices

Philomena has a few charming nickname options. "Phil" is a classic and friendly choice. "Mena" is a sweet and more casual option. The name also lends itself to creative variations like "Millie" or "Lenny," offering a range of informal options.

Variation and Similar Names

Variations of Philomena include:

  • Philomene: This variation is common in some European countries and adds a touch of whimsy.
  • Filomena: A more streamlined version, often seen in Italian culture.
